Solve for c:
c2 - 9c + 18 = 0
| 3 or 6 | |
| 8 or -1 | |
| 6 or -6 | |
| 4 or 1 |
The first step to solve a quadratic equation that's set to zero is to factor the quadratic equation:
c2 - 9c + 18 = 0
(c - 3)(c - 6) = 0
For this expression to be true, the left side of the expression must equal zero. Therefore, either (c - 3) or (c - 6) must equal zero:
If (c - 3) = 0, c must equal 3
If (c - 6) = 0, c must equal 6
So the solution is that c = 3 or 6

A line on the coordinate grid can be defined by a slope-intercept equation: y = mx + b. For a given value of x, the value of y can be determined given the slope (m) and y-intercept (b) of the line. The slope of a line is change in y over change in x, \({\Delta y \over \Delta x}\), and the y-intercept is the y-coordinate where the line crosses the vertical y-axis.

The coordinate grid is composed of a horizontal x-axis and a vertical y-axis. The center of the grid, where the x-axis and y-axis meet, is called the origin.
